Job overview

The Cottesloe School is a successful and oversubscribed Foundation Secondary School with Sixth Form situated in the village of Wing in rural North Buckinghamshire, located conveniently for Milton Keynes, Bedfordshire and Hertfordshire.

We are a caring school with highly qualified and exceptionally committed staff, who recognise the importance of creative and challenging teaching and high professional standards.  All staff and students are greatly valued and emphasis on student and staff wellbeing is central to our culture.

* Ofsted rated Good in all areas - July 2016

* CPD Award Mark of Outstanding

We are looking for a dynamic part-time (0.6) teacher with a desire to help drive and develop a flourishing department with ideas that enthuse, engage and enhance student learning.  You will need to demonstrate a vision of how the learning of Science could look in the future.  Specialisms in Chemistry or Physics would be an advantage. There is the possibility of a TLR for a suitable candidate.

We can offer you an exciting opportunity to work in a welcoming and supportive environment for students and staff alike. Our students are courteous and have a high degree of respect for others. They are proud of their school and enjoy learning. Parents are positive about the behaviour of students and say they are managed well and staff are similarly positive (Ofsted July 2016).

This is an ideal opportunity for either an Early Career Teacher to undertake their induction training in a school with a proven track record of providing excellent professional support for all staff, or for an experienced teacher looking for a new challenge or return to teaching in a supportive and welcoming school.

The Cottesloe School is a successful and oversubscribed Foundation secondary school situated in the village of Wing in rural North Buckinghamshire.

Headteacher  Mr Simon Jones, MA

NOR: 1,070 including 126 in Sixth Form

Values and vision

The Cottesloe School’s staff are fully committed to maximising the life chances of all of our students by creating a rich, deep, vibrant and challenging learning experience for everyone. Our students benefit from highly qualified and exceptionally committed staff who recognise the importance of creative and challenging teaching, strong pastoral care and have high professional standards.

Our curriculum has carefully designed pathways to make sure it meets the needs of all our students. It provides an excellent range of options in GCSE and A Level qualifications supported by a range of vocational courses.

Prepare, Aspire, Succeed is borne out of a simple philosophy of what we believe is the purpose of education.

Prepare, Aspire, Succeed is what we do - it is what defines us as a school and it encapsulates all that is unique and strong about The Cottesloe School.

A focus on working towards academic excellence across the school is complemented by a commitment to providing the emotional support students need to recognise their potential. This is the purpose of The Cottesloe School’s TEAM Hub (Together Everyone Achieves More) centre. If a Head of Year identifies further support is necessary, interventions such as anger management and stress management are made available through drop in sessions or through professional counselling.
